- [ ] Step 7: Archive cold storage buckets (Glacierline tier). Confirm both ceremony witnesses are present, verify bucket manifests match the Oxbow ledger, then seal the archive key shares. Plugin authors may observe but not handle shares. Once sealed, the archive index itself is encrypted and can only be reopened with the passphrase below.

vault phrase of badup-hahig = tamael-aldael-kelmir-istael-fenok-istwyn-tamius-jorath-oliion

Subject: Tracing setup for the Quillbrook integration

Hi, and welcome aboard. As you wire your services into the Quillbrook mesh, please propagate our trace header on every outbound call, including retries — dropped headers are the main reason spans appear orphaned in the Lanternview dashboard. Sampling is set to 20% in staging, so don't panic if some requests vanish. To query the trace API directly while you're validating your integration, authenticate with the token below.

login token, yagaf-hawip: eyJhbGciOiJIUzI1NiIsInR5cCI6IkpXVCJ9.eyJzdWIiOiIdHjlcNIn0.AFyH-u9q

Handover note — Crumbwheel order cutoffs.

Welcome aboard. The bakery cutoff rule in Crumbwheel closes same-day orders at 14:00 local to each storefront, not UTC — this has bitten us twice. Holiday overrides live in the calendar service and take precedence silently, so always check there first when a cutoff looks wrong. To unlock the calendar service's admin console after a restart, enter the recovery passphrase below.

vault phrase of bagap-bahaf = silion-pelox-sorox-casdor-quenwyn-fraax-eliox-praael-kelion-quenvan-kasox-rusael-norius-belvan

## Kiosk Watchdog — Onboarding

The Orvane kiosk app runs a watchdog process that restarts the UI if it stops heartbeating for 30 seconds. As a contractor, you'll mostly touch the watchdog config, not the app itself. Config changes ship as signed bundles pushed to kiosks overnight; unsigned bundles are rejected at boot. Build the bundle with the packaging script, then sign it before upload. Use the deploy key shown here:

rollout seal: bky4_DFM9